
The Peru energy drinks market is expected to expand steadily, with value projected to rise by USD 90.2 million between 2025 and 2030, translating into a compound annual growth rate of about 6.52%. Demand is being shaped by a widening consumer base, particularly among younger demographics who increasingly incorporate energy drinks into their weekly routines. This shift has reinforced the category’s position in the broader non-alcoholic beverages sector, establishing it as a mainstream choice rather than a niche indulgence. The normalization of consumption among teens and young adults continues to underpin momentum, creating favorable conditions for sustained expansion.
Yet, the market’s growth trajectory is also defined by high levels of price sensitivity. Consumers’ focus on affordability has propelled the expansion of lower-priced brands, which are capturing share by offering competitive alternatives to established players. In response, leading manufacturers have diversified their portfolios, introducing budget-friendly lines to retain relevance across different income groups. This dynamic has intensified competition, with companies leveraging innovation in packaging and flavor development to differentiate offerings while maintaining accessibility. Novel formulations, ranging from tropical blends to functional variants targeting specific lifestyle needs, are becoming central to competitive positioning.
At the same time, evolving perceptions of health and wellness are beginning to exert influence on purchasing decisions. Although not yet the dominant driver of consumption, concerns over high sugar and caffeine content are growing, particularly among urban, health-conscious consumers. These concerns are expected to shape regulatory discussions in the medium term, potentially prompting restrictions or labeling requirements that could alter the operating environment. For manufacturers, this shift also creates opportunities in the form of reduced-sugar, zero-sugar, or naturally fortified energy drinks, which are likely to resonate more strongly with consumers prioritizing balance between functionality and wellbeing.
Overall, the Peruvian energy drinks market is navigating a dual-track dynamic—on one hand, robust short-term growth driven by youth-led consumption and competitive pricing, and on the other, the emergence of longer-term shifts linked to health awareness and regulatory oversight. Companies that can balance affordability with innovation, while gradually adapting to rising wellness expectations, are best positioned to consolidate growth in the coming years.

Competitive Landscape
The competitive landscape of the industry has been analyzed, featuring profiles of major players such as Somos Industrias San Miguel (ISM), Red Bull GmbH, Monster Beverage Corporation, Central America Bottling Corporation (CBC) and AJE Group.
